    After having the front fenders and hood set up I decided to move to the rear so I could have some time to think about how I would tackle the front grill and headlight mounts.

    A large part of this build is bracing and strengthening the chassis as much as possible. The amount these frames flex from the factory is pretty crazy. The entire goal on a build like this is to let the suspension do the work.

    The plates are made from 1/8” with internal gusseting at what will be the tube landings.

    After wrapping up the majority of the rear, I hopped back on the front clip and started fabricating the mounts for the headlights and grill.

    This was a little challenging to do as only a couple of mounts on the second gen core support worked, so nothing was really supported in any fashion. Tape and patience saved the day. I used 1” 16g tube for this. It is considerably more stout than what the factory trucks have. Hopefully this saves some headlights from breaking.
